Experimental but monotonous six track vinyl only EP from Montreal duo, Thus Owls
A six track EP from Montreal duo Thus Owls sports a rather attractive minimalist cover that gives no hint of the content of the enclosed disc. I was suspecting a rather ambient offering due to the liner notes declaring the involvement of Icelandic composer and producer Daniel Bjarnason whose work I admire, but ‘Black Matter’ turns out to be a fairly dark and brooding affair. The band claimed that this release would be a “stripped back” and experimental work but that is not how I heard the album. For me the concept has a claustrophobic element that subdues the listening experience. Foremost in the mix are the impassioned vocals of singer Erika Angell whose powerful delivery lends an air of desperation to the opener ‘Asleep in the Water’. The gothic noir atmosphere envelopes all six tracks and gives the feeling of being hidden behind thick dark curtains where hardly a shaft of light can sneak in. Sonically ‘Black Matter’ is interesting rather than experimental and does not really stray from a sense of despair. The title track is synth heavy and is really trying hard to be strange, but feels quite contrived and lacking any real passion . There is no real change of atmosphere to grab your interest. ‘Shields’ is a mellow affair and possibly the most effective cut on show here. The spooky feel returns with ‘Turn Up the Volume’ but the composition gets swallowed up in its own monotony. The instrumental track ‘Vector’ could be a Vangelis out-take from ‘Blade Runner’. As the final track ‘We Leave/We Forget’ drags to a close my overall conclusion that ‘Black Matter’ lacks a certain authenticity and vibrancy that leaves a sense of sadness. Perhaps that is how it should be?
